Name of the Condition
- Multiple fractures of ribs, bilateral, subsequent encounter for fracture with delayed healing (ICD-10-CM Code: S22.43XG)
Summary
This condition involves fractures affecting two or more ribs on both sides of the chest, with delayed healing observed during a subsequent encounter for treatment. Rib fractures may occur in a single area or span multiple segments of the rib cage. The rib cage protects vital organs, and bilateral fractures can increase the risk of complications such as respiratory distress or internal organ damage. The term "subsequent encounter" indicates active treatment is ongoing, and "delayed healing" reflects a prolonged recovery process.
Causes
Multiple bilateral rib fractures are commonly caused by direct trauma, such as motor vehicle accidents, falls, or high-impact injuries. Blunt force to the chest or back can lead to fractures in multiple ribs, while severe compression injuries may affect adjacent ribs. Osteoporosis or other bone-weakening conditions can increase susceptibility to fractures even with minor trauma. Delayed healing may result from factors like poor blood supply, infection, or inadequate immobilization.
Risk Factors
- Age (older adults with reduced bone density)
- Participation in high-risk activities or contact sports
- Osteoporosis or other bone disorders
- History of previous fractures or trauma
- Certain medical conditions affecting bone strength
- Smoking or poor nutrition
Symptoms
- Persistent severe localized pain in the chest or rib area
- Difficulty breathing or shortness of breath
- Swelling, bruising, or tenderness at the injury site
- Limited range of motion or difficulty moving
- Possible deformity or misalignment in severe cases
- Prolonged healing time compared to typical recovery
Diagnosis
Physical examination to assess tenderness, swelling, or deformity. Imaging studies, such as X-rays or CT scans, to confirm fracture location and healing status. Evaluation of respiratory function to rule out complications. Review of medical history and prior treatment to determine if healing is delayed.
Treatment Options
Pain management with medications or nerve blocks. Breathing exercises to prevent complications like pneumonia. Immobilization or supportive devices to stabilize the rib cage. Surgical intervention in severe cases with internal fixation. Monitoring for signs of delayed healing or infection.
Prognosis and Follow-Up
Prognosis depends on fracture severity, patient health, and treatment adherence. Most fractures heal within 6–8 weeks, but delayed healing may extend recovery. Follow-up appointments to assess healing progress and adjust treatment. Rehabilitation may be needed to restore mobility and strength.
Complications
- Respiratory distress or pneumonia
- Internal organ damage (e.g., lung or spleen)
- Chronic pain or discomfort
- Nonunion or malunion of fractures
- Infection at the injury site
Lifestyle & Prevention
Avoid high-risk activities without proper protection. Maintain bone health through diet and exercise. Use seatbelts and avoid falls. Quit smoking to improve healing. Follow post-injury care instructions to support recovery.
When to Seek Professional Help
Seek immediate care for severe pain, difficulty breathing, or signs of internal injury. Contact a provider if pain worsens, swelling increases, or healing does not progress as expected.
Tips for Medical Coders
Document the bilateral nature of the fractures, the subsequent encounter status, and evidence of delayed healing (e.g., imaging reports or clinical notes). Ensure the code aligns with the patient’s current treatment phase and healing progress. Verify that all relevant details are captured to support accurate coding.
